Finding light for Velvet Mesquite in your home
a window
Velvet Mesquite may have difficulty thriving, and will drop leaves 🍃, without ample sunlight.
Place it less than 3 feet from a south-facing window to maximize the potential for growth.

How to fertilize Velvet Mesquite
Most potting soils come with ample nutrients which plants use to produce new growth.
By the time your plant has depleted the nutrients in its soil it’s likely grown enough to need a larger pot anyway.
To replenish this plant's nutrients, repot your Velvet Mesquite after it doubles in size or once a year—whichever comes first.
